#include<iostream.h>
#include<conio.h>
class sum
{
int x;
public:
//constructor
sum()
{
x=89;
cout<<"\nx = "<<x;
}
sum(int n)
{
x=n;
cout<<"\nx = "<<x;
}
sum(sum &obj)
{
x=obj.x;
cout<<"\nCopied Value = "<<x;
}
};
void main()
{
clrscr();
cout<<"\nDefault Constructor";
sum s1;
cout<<"\nParametrized Constructor";
sum s2(34);
cout<<"\nCopy Constructor";
sum s3(s2);
getch();
}
#include<conio.h>
class sum
{
int x;
public:
//constructor
sum()
{
x=89;
cout<<"\nx = "<<x;
}
sum(int n)
{
x=n;
cout<<"\nx = "<<x;
}
sum(sum &obj)
{
x=obj.x;
cout<<"\nCopied Value = "<<x;
}
};
void main()
{
clrscr();
cout<<"\nDefault Constructor";
sum s1;
cout<<"\nParametrized Constructor";
sum s2(34);
cout<<"\nCopy Constructor";
sum s3(s2);
getch();
}
No comments:
Post a Comment